E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
ifdef
ST电机库(digital_output)
#
ifdef
__cplusplusextern"C"{#endif/*__cplusplus*/为了支持C++语言,需要在头文件中使用extern"C"包住函数声明,这样编译器会按照C语言的方式进行链接
mark_shan716
·
2023-10-30 17:21
c++
单片机
c语言
ST电机库(circle_limitation)
#
ifdef
__cplusplusextern"C"{#endif/*__cplusplus*/为了支持C++语言,需要在头文件中使用extern"C"包住函数声明,这样编译器会按照C语言的方式进行链接
mark_shan716
·
2023-10-30 17:51
c++
c语言
链表
MFC绘图(笔记)
public:virtual~CMFC程序View();#
ifdef
_DEBUGvirtualvoidAssertValid()const;virtualvoidDump(CDumpContext&dc
yjx23332
·
2023-10-30 04:59
MFC(笔记)
mfc
C语言------基础关键词:strcmp、strtok、atoi、三目运算符、->运算符、
ifdef
endif打调试信息、memset、memcpy、malloc、enum、typedef
C语言------基础关键词1、strcmpstrcmp会根据ASCII编码依次比较两个字符串的每一个字符,直到出现找不到的字符,或者到达字符串的末尾(\0)。strcmp是比较两个字符串,用法如下:原函数:int strcmp(constchar*,constchar*);举例:intres;chars1='a';chars2='b';res=strcmp(s1,s2);printf("re
哆啦哆小魔仙
·
2023-10-30 01:20
C语言基础知识
c语言
C语言使用line出现错误,C语言#error和#line使用方法
C语言#error和#line使用方法一、使用方法:1、#error方法:2、#line方法:二、代码测试:1、#error#include#
ifdef
__cplusplus#errorthisfileshouldbeprocessedwithC
weixin_39961636
·
2023-10-30 01:19
C语言使用line出现错误
QT C++ AES字符串加密实现
然后在cpp中直接引入使用即可类库的下载地址https://download.csdn.net/download/u012372365/88478671具体代码:#include#include#
ifdef
康小岱
·
2023-10-28 07:09
qt
c++
开发语言
uin-app 的条件编译(APP-PLUS 、H5、MP-WEIXIN )
写法:以#
ifdef
或#ifndef加%PLATFORM%开头,以#endif结尾。
前端陈陈陈
·
2023-10-26 19:13
C/C++实现的MD5哈希校验
#ifndefMD5_H#defineMD5_H#
ifdef
__cplusplusextern"C"{#endiftypedefstruct{unsignedintcount[2];unsignedintstate
觉皇嵌入式
·
2023-10-26 09:29
C/C++
算法
1024程序员节
jni.h头文件详解(一)
#defineJNIEXPORT#defineJNIIMPORT#defineJNICALLtypedefintjint;#
ifdef
_LP64/*64-bitSolaris*/ty
左少华
·
2023-10-26 07:03
STM32F103 单片机定时器中断实验
timer.h代码如下:/**timer.h**Createdon:2023-10-24*Author:Fiyduo*/#ifndefTIMER_TIMER_H_#defineTIMER_TIMER_H_#
ifdef
飞多学堂
·
2023-10-26 01:25
STM32
STM32
C语言函数返回值不能直接写数组
C语言返回值不能直接写数组#ifndef_VMATH_H#define_VMATH_H#
ifdef
_cplusplusextern"C"{#endiftypedeffloatMatrix44f[16];
木犀花香
·
2023-10-25 09:04
其他
C语言
C++常见面试题整理
编译和调试C/C++程序编译过程C/C++程序编译过程就是把C/C++代码百年城可执行文件的过程,该过程分为4步预处理阶段进行宏展开和宏替换处理条件编译指令,如#
ifdef
,#endif等去掉注释添加行号和文件名标识保留
weixin_43183320
·
2023-10-24 10:58
c++
面试
编程语言
Verilog编译预处理
文章目录一、简介二、宏定义`define三、文件包含`include四、时间尺度`timescale五、条件编译`
ifdef
参考一、简介编译预处理是VerilogHDL编译系统的一个组成部分。
暴风雨中的白杨
·
2023-10-23 22:17
FPGA
fpga
预编译
ifdef
GCC编译器 & 什么是宏?& 标识符和关键字
预处理阶段:gcc会处理源代码中的预处理指令,如"#include,#define,#
ifdef
等。将宏
computer_vision_chen
·
2023-10-23 09:25
C++笔记
C/C++
runtime-class
defineFAST_DATA_MASK0x00007ffffffffff8ULstructclass_ro_t{uint32_tflags;uint32_tinstanceStart;uint32_tinstanceSize;#
ifdef
Berning
·
2023-10-22 10:26
C/C++学习笔记:预处理命令
预处理命令文章目录预处理命令例子#if,#elif,#else,#endif文件包含命令#include用法头文件写法示例宏定义命令#define条件编译#if、#
ifdef
、#ifndef☆预处理总结
Fang_cheng_
·
2023-10-21 21:00
学习笔记
c++
c语言
预编译
戴伟来博问闪存联系管理iOS中的预编译指令的初步探究目录文件包含#include#include_next#import宏定义#define#undef条件编译#if#else#endif#ifdefine#
ifdef
li_yangyang_li
·
2023-10-21 10:11
iOS
开发
__declspec(dllexport)
details/38561831https://blog.csdn.net/Repeaterbin/article/details/42696661.用法在VS的“预编译”选项里定义_EXPORTING宏#
ifdef
_EXPOR
朔方烟尘
·
2023-10-20 23:48
[书签]C/C++获得类成员变量偏移和成员函数地址
defined_CRT_USE_BUILTIN_OFFSETOF#
ifdef
__cplusplus#defineoffsetof(s,m)((::size_t)&reinterpret_cast((((
珏_Gray
·
2023-10-20 01:09
gcc编译C语言
编译流程命令作用解释预处理阶段gcc-Ehello.c-ohello.i该过程会对各种预处理指令(以#开头的代码行,如#include,#define,#
ifdef
等等)
余生羁绊
·
2023-10-19 22:16
Linux
c语言
ubuntu
linux
Win32 简单日志实现
单个日志文件大小上限,自动超时保存日志,日志缓存超限保存CLogUtils.h#pragmaonce#include#include#include#include#include#include#include#
ifdef
_UNICODEusing_tstring
Flame_Cyclone
·
2023-10-19 21:45
c++
windows
Win32
wxWidgets创建文件夹
wxStringpathSeparator="/";#
ifdef
_WIN32pathSeparator="\\";#endifwxStringdirPath=wxStandardPaths::Get()
haimianjie2012
·
2023-10-19 02:04
前端
服务器
linux
【面试】c++编译过程//指针和引用的区别//‘malloc / free’ 和 ‘new / delete’的区别//关键字static的作用//const关键字的作用
其中包括:展开所有的宏定义;处理所有的条件编译指令,如“#if”,"#
ifdef
"等等;将“#include”指令包
问~
·
2023-10-17 19:41
c++原理
面试
面试
c++
编译器
内存结构
IOS基础知识-宏定义使用
(a):(b))指令与作用:#空指令,无任何效果#define定义宏#undef取消已定义的宏#if如果给定条件为真,则编译下面代码#
ifdef
如果宏已经定义,则编译下面代码#ifndef如果宏没有定义
程序员的自我救赎
·
2023-10-17 17:03
Effective C++中文版_读书笔记
预处理:#开头的语句1.宏定义:#define2.头文件包含:#include3.条件编译:#
ifdef
~#else#endif#ifndef#define//防止重复编译宏定义的预处理最好用const
PTF_BIN
·
2023-10-17 04:08
读书笔记
读书笔记
2021-08-09 uni-app基础教程 条件编译
写法:以#
ifdef
或#ifndef加%PLATFORM%开头,以#endif结尾。
微软MVP Eleven
·
2023-10-16 23:34
uin-app
uni-app 不同平台的 条件编译
uni-app不同平台的条件编译条件编译是用特殊的注释作为标记,在编译时根据这些特殊的注释,将注释里面的代码编译到不同平台开头:#
ifdef
或#ifndef+%PLATFORM%;结尾:#endif;#
茶憶
·
2023-10-16 23:33
uni-app
uni-app
开发平台
uni-app条件编译
写法:以#
ifdef
或#ifndef加%PLATFORM%开头,以#endif结尾。
qx_6569
·
2023-10-16 23:32
前端
uni-app
uni-app
uni-app在不同平台 样式不同以及方法等 条件编译
根据不同的平台改变不同的样式写法:以#
ifdef
或#ifndef加%PLATFORM%开头,以#endif结尾。
Mr_wuying
·
2023-10-16 23:31
uni-app
uni-app
YYText中YYLabel和YYTextView适配暗黑模式
NSMutableAttributedString中必须要传NSForegroundColorAttributeName,适配好颜色YYLabel.m添加如下代码#pragmamark-DarkModeAdapater#
ifdef
富春江水
·
2023-10-16 23:26
VS 解决方案 exe 调用 dll 导出函数
创建一个MFCdll或者win32,这里以MFCdll为列1:在MFCdll里面创建一个对象类MdbObj2:在MdbObj.h里面增加导入和导出宏#
ifdef
_DLL_SAMPLE#defineDLL_SAMPLE_API
weekbo
·
2023-10-16 22:03
mfc
windows
c++
条件编译:#if #
ifdef
#ifndef #elif #else #endif的用法
********************************************/#define定义一个预处理宏#undef取消宏的定义#if编译预处理中的条件命令,相当于C语法中的if语句#
ifdef
明日太阳依然升起
·
2023-10-16 11:42
STM32
c语言
开发语言
stm32
单片机
条件编译指令 #define #undef #
ifdef
#ifndef #endif
话不多说,下面通过简单的说明几个例子说明这几个的用法定义与取消定义定义AAA为111#defineAAA111定义AAA,但没定义AAA的值#defineAAA取消定义AAA,之前定义的AAA无效#undefAAA选择性定义如果定义了AAA,那么就定义ZZZ为222#ifdefAAA#defineZZZ222#endif如果没有定义AAA,那么就定义ZZZ为222#ifndefAAA#define
iot 小胡
·
2023-10-16 11:11
#
C/C++
c语言
宏定义
#define
条件编译
c语言常用的条件编译,C语言条件编译
编译器GCC#
ifdef
__GNUC__#if__GNUC__>=3//GCC3.0以上VisualC++#
ifdef
_MSC_VER(非VC编译器很多地方也有定义)#if_MSC_VER>=1000/
读书分享
·
2023-10-16 11:40
c语言常用的条件编译
c语言的条件编译 if,C语言的条件编译#if, #elif, #else, #endif、#
ifdef
, #ifndef
有些程序在调试、兼容性、平台移植等状况下可能想要经过简单地设置一些参数就生成一个不一样的软件,这固然能够经过变量设置,把全部可能用到的代码都写进去,在初始化时配置,但在不一样的状况下可能只用到一部分代码,就不必把全部的代码都写进去,就能够用条件编译,经过预编译指令设置编译条件,在不一样的须要时编译不一样的代码。函数(一)条件编译方法调试条件编译是经过预编译指令来实现的,主要方法有:code一、#i
焦虑中
·
2023-10-16 11:39
c语言的条件编译
if
C语言预处理命令:#include/#define/#undef/#if/#elif#
ifdef
/#ifndef/#endif
预处理命令:#include/#define/#undef/#if/#elif#
ifdef
/#ifndef/#endif#include和#define#include#define#undef#if、
一只不出息的程序员
·
2023-10-16 11:38
C语言
c语言
c++
C语言条件编译#if_#elif_#
ifdef
_#ifndef
假如要开发一款产品,开始的程序一般会利用前面已开发完毕的程序,但是程序的时钟可能不是我们需要的,时钟的变化会导致串口波特率的产生偏差,这时候我们可以利用宏来选择/************系统时钟频率定义,主要用于配置UART波特率**********/#if(SYSCLK_SRC==IRCH)#defineFOSC(3686400)#elif(SYSCLK_SRC==PLL)#definePLL_
c1278943913
·
2023-10-16 11:31
C
c语言
单片机
开发语言
【C语言_宏定义/预处理&条件编译】宏定义;条件编译-#
ifdef
,#else,#endif
#
ifdef
,#else,#endif预处理就是在进行编译的第一遍词法扫描和语法分析之前所作的工作。说白了,就是对源文件进行编译前,先对预处理部分进行处理,然后对处理后的代码进行编译。
拾贰_C
·
2023-10-16 11:26
{05}C语言
c语言
开发语言
c++
c#
C语言练习百题之#
ifdef
和#ifndef的应用
#if,#
ifdef
,和#ifndef是C语言预处理指令,它们可以用于条件编译,帮助控制程序的编译过程。
失去的十年
·
2023-10-16 04:33
C语言练习百题
c语言
单片机
stm32
基础
#endif#defineXXX0//#
ifdef
只关心宏是否被定义//第一段条件编译,是逻辑1被编译#ifdefXXX逻辑1#else逻辑2#endif//#if既关心宏是否定义,又关心宏的逻辑的真假
zsg555666
·
2023-10-16 01:22
c语言源程序执行过程中 有哪些步骤,C语言源码到可执行程序一般要经过以下的处理步骤...
从C语言源码到可执行程序一般要经过以下的处理步骤:预处理在这一阶段,源码中的所有预处理语句得到处理,例如#include语句所包含的文件内容替换掉语句本身所有已定义的宏被展开根据#
ifdef
,#if等语句的条件是否成立取舍相应的部分预处理之后源码中不再包含任何预处理语句
咸鱼豆腐
·
2023-10-16 01:46
c语言源程序执行过程中
有哪些步骤
Visual Studio创建Dll、Lib以及在项目中调用
Dll和lib进行调用使用;2、实现步骤2.1第一个项目如何新建项目这里不再赘述头文件def.h#pragmaonce#ifndef__WEIDUAN_H__#define__WEIDUAN_H__#
ifdef
蜗先森
·
2023-10-15 07:50
windows
microsoft
Linux系统编程01
C语言程序编译过程多个源文件生成一个可执行文件的过程预处理阶段主要是将带#号的类似于#include#define#
ifdef
等进行处理替换gcc-S下面讲解C语言源代码编译成汇编语言之后,之间的对应情况源代码使用
一只叮铛
·
2023-10-14 23:08
Linux
linux
c++
c语言
ffmpeg读取本地视频,获取视频帧
本文转自:https://blog.csdn.net/yinsui1839/article/details/80519742/*********本代码参考自雷神博客***********/#
ifdef
_
piaopiaopiaopiaopiao
·
2023-10-14 10:53
视频编码
C
预处理条件语句的逻辑运算
#
ifdef
与或运算#
ifdef
(MIN)&&(MAX)----------------------------错误使用#ifdefined(MIN)&&defined(MAX)------------
workingwei
·
2023-10-14 10:59
C/C++基础
linux
编译
JPEG转为DICOM文件
Createdbyyeti//========================================================================/*convert.h*/#
ifdef
荒原独歌
·
2023-10-14 08:19
DICOM
dll
callback
pointers
attributes
dataset
byte
C++跨平台基于log4cpp二次单例封装
_#include#include//strrchr()函数所需头文件#include#include#include#include#include#include#include#include#
ifdef
_WIN32
Word哥
·
2023-10-13 19:47
spdlog简单封装 单例模式
spdlog使用说明:https://github.com/gabime/spdlog/wiki常见的头开始部分#
ifdef
_WIN32#define__FILENAME__(strrchr(__FILE
玉梅小洋
·
2023-10-13 19:16
C++
单例模式
c++
开发语言
msvc2019使用filesystem
#define_USE_STD_FILESYSTEM#
ifdef
_USE_STD_FILESYSTEM#include#if_HAS_CXX17#includenamespacefs=std::filesystem
yezishuang
·
2023-10-13 15:39
c++
c++
#if#
ifdef
#define等宏定义使用
吐槽:为了提前适配iOS11,在xcode9beta版使用过程中,有时候xcode9beta看图层一点击就卡死啊,还得强退才行;playground全局搜索代码有时候失效啊;打包啊….��都得换回xcode8才行。。。最近碰到了个代码执行问题,iOS11中一些新的API在xdode8中报错,每次切换xcode时,都得去注释掉这段代码,麻烦死了。怎么让一段代码在xcode8和9都能顺利编译不报错,可
DonnyDN
·
2023-10-13 11:52
iOS开发
ios
宏
xcode
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他